Savannah Global Solutions, LLC

Caught in running equipment or machinery during maintenance, cleaning · Fractures

Federal OSHA recorded a severe workplace injury at Savannah Global Solutions, LLC, 147 E. Industrial Blvd, PEMBROKE, GEORGIA 31321 on , Fractures, affecting the forearm(s).

An employee was cleaning a hitch pin on a manual lathe using a terrycloth rag. The rag was pulled into the spinning three-jaw chuck, pulling his left arm into the machine. The employee sustained an open left arm fracture three inches above the wrist.

Hospitalized Forearm(s) Lathes, unspecified
